US backs findings in Malaysian plane crash, holds Russia accountable

WASHINGTON, May 25 (KUNA) -- The US said Thursday that it has "complete confidence" in the findings of the Joint Investigation Team (JIT) presented by the Dutch Public Prosecutor on Malaysia Airline Flight MH17, said a State Department memo.
The missile launcher used to shoot down the plane originated from the 53rd Anti-aircraft Brigade of Russia, stationed in Kursk.
"We recall the UN Security Council's demand that 'those responsible... be held to account and that all States cooperate fully with efforts to establish accountability,' said the statement.
"It is time for Russia to cease its lies and account for its role in the shoot down." The US remains confident in the Dutch criminal justice system to prosecute those responsible, it added. (end) ak.gta
